Klavarog is a free, open source virtual piano keyboard for Windows and Linux systems. It is designed to be simple and small while offering various customization options.
Tach Typing Tutor is a free typing tutorial program that helps users learn and practice touch typing. It uses interactive lessons, speed tests, and games to help improve typing speed and accuracy.
